Oregon's diverse climate, ranging from the wet, temperate coastal regions to the drier eastern plains, presents unique challenges and considerations for septic system design and installation. The significant annual rainfall in many parts of the state mandates careful attention to drainage and effluent dispersal to prevent system failure and groundwater contamination.
In Oregon, septic system regulations are overseen by the Oregon Department of Environmental Quality (DEQ) and local health authorities, emphasizing the importance of proper design and installation to protect the state's abundant natural waterways. The housing stock often includes older homes in established neighborhoods and newer developments in suburban areas, each with varying requirements for septic system upgrades or new installations. Considerations such as soil type, lot size, and proximity to surface water bodies heavily influence the selection of tank material (e.g., concrete, fiberglass, polyethylene) and the type of drain field system, including conventional, mound, or drip dispersal.

For a 2000 sq ft house in Oregon, the septic tank size is typically determined by the number of bedrooms and local DEQ or county health department standards, generally requiring a capacity in the range of 1000-1250 gallons. The chosen system and drain field design will be further specified based on thorough site evaluations, including soil percolation tests. Proper sizing is critical for effective wastewater management.

Installing your own septic system in Oregon can be a complex undertaking, requiring a deep understanding of DEQ regulations, site evaluation protocols, and construction techniques. While potentially saving on labor costs, the risk of non-compliance, improper installation leading to system failure, or environmental damage is significant. Oregon's climate significantly influences septic system installation and maintenance. The abundant rainfall in many regions necessitates careful consideration of drainage and soil saturation for drain field design to prevent premature failure and groundwater contamination. In drier eastern areas, water conservation measures might influence system sizing. Year-round performance depends on selecting materials and designs that can withstand temperature fluctuations and moisture levels.
